A few years ago, a
young marine corporal named Joey Mora was standing on a platform of an
aircraft carrier that was patrolling the Iranian Sea.
Incredibly, he fell overboard His absence
was not known for 36 hours.
A search and rescue mission began, but was
given up on after an additional 24 hours.
No one could survive in the sea without
even a life jacket after 60 hours.
His parents were notified that he was
"missing and presumed dead."
The rest of the story is one of those
"truth is stranger than fiction" events.
Scriptwriters would pass it up as "not
believable."
Four Pakistani fishermen found Joey Mora about 72 hours after he had fallen from the aircraft carrier.
He was treading water, clinging to a
makeshift flotation device made from his trousers a skill learned in most
military courses on survival training.
He was delirious when they pulled him into their
fishing boat. His tongue was dry and cracked and his throat
parched.
Just about two years later, as he spoke on
NBC News, he recounted an unbelievable story .of a WILL to
live.
He said it was God .... It was God....who kept
him struggling to survive.
His discovery by the fishermen makes
searching for a needle in a haystack a piece of cake.
Joey said that the one thought that took over
his body and pounded in his brain was, "Water!.... Water!"
